Tajima DG16 by Pulse is a professional embroidery digitizing software that introduced several advanced features for personalization and automation. While some users search for "crack" or "repack" versions to avoid high costs (retail can be approximately $8,500 USD), these unauthorized versions lack critical updates and official support.
Below are the standout legitimate features of the DG16 software: Advanced Personalization & Design
180+ High-Quality Fonts: Includes over 180 standard embroidery fonts with auto-kerning and the ability for users to create their own via a Font Creator tool.
AutoTrace & Autodigitizing: Easily converts images into Bezier curves and embroidery segments. The Autodigitizing Wizard includes a "Color Merge" setting to refine how different colors are assigned to generated segments.
Creative Stitch Effects: Features specialized stitch types such as Spiral Fill, Fur Stitch, Cascade Stitch, and Contour Stitch for more artistic, textured designs. Cloud Connectivity & Accessibility
PulseCloud Integration: Allows users to manage up to 100,000 designs online, monitor machine performance in real-time, and access designs from mobile devices.
Freeform Cloud Designer: Users can create designs remotely in a web browser, enabling flexible workflows across multiple devices. Production & Workflow Tools

One-Step Alignment: A simplified feature for centering segments vertically, horizontally, or both simultaneously.
Automatic Applique: Combines fabrics with embroidery automatically for unique mixed-media creations. Tiered Versions for Specific Needs
The software is available in several editions tailored to different business sizes:
Maestro: The flagship level for industrial automation, featuring advanced vector functions and multi-head machine support.
Illustrator Extreme: Focused on premium digitizing with refined drawing tools and complex contour stitching.
Artist Plus: Geared toward artistic studios with tools for intricate designs and beadwork.
Creator: A foundational level for beginners or small shops focusing on standard digitizing and outline editing.
Composer: Dedicated primarily to name embroidery and lettering. Security Risks of Unauthorized Versions

Tajima DG16 is the 16th version of the Pulse embroidery suite. It is designed to bridge the gap between graphic design and embroidery, allowing users to convert vector art into stitches with extreme precision. Key features of the official software include: Advanced vector-to-stitch conversion engines. Support for specialty stitches like sequins and chenille. Seamless integration with Tajima embroidery machines. Cloud-based services for design management and sharing. Enhanced automation for repetitive digitizing tasks.
